Understanding the Role of a Voice Process Executive

A Voice Process Executive plays a crucial role in maintaining effective communication between a company and its clients. Typically engaged in customer service, support, and telemarketing tasks, these professionals must exhibit excellent linguistic abilities, problem-solving skills, and cultural awareness to excel in their roles.

Key Skills for Success

To thrive as a voice process executive, certain skills and qualities are paramount. Let's delve into the primary competencies required for success in the international voice process industry:

Communication Skills

Exceptional verbal communication is the cornerstone of a successful career in voice processes. Clear articulation, active listening, and an adaptable tone ensure seamless interactions, fostering positive client experiences.

Language Proficiency

Proficiency in multiple languages or a native-level command of English is often required, given the international clientele. The ability to grasp accents and nuances quickly can set you apart in this competitive field.

Technical Proficiency

Familiarity with CRM software and call center technologies, alongside a rudimentary understanding of IT tools, equips you to handle client interactions efficiently.

Cultural Sensitivity

Understanding and respecting diverse cultures allow for more personalized and respectful communication, enhancing the overall client relationship.


Education and Training

While a formal degree may not be mandatory, having a background in communication, business administration, or related fields can be advantageous. Furthermore, engaging in relevant training programs and certifications can amplify your expertise: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Communications, Business, or related fields.
  • Certification in Customer Service or Call Center Operations.
  • Language proficiency certifications like TOEFL or IELTS if applicable.

Career Pathways and Opportunities

International Voice Process Executives are integral to many industries, including BPOs, ITES, Hospitality, and Travel. Let's explore potential career trajectories:

Entry-Level Positions

Starting as a Customer Support Executive or Telecaller allows you to gain substantial experience and insight into client management and inter-cultural communication.

Mid-Level Positions

Progression to Team Lead or Process Trainer positions generally follows, wherein individuals hone leadership skills and aid in optimizing communications processes.

Senior-Level Positions

Experienced professionals can transition into roles such as Operations Manager, Customer Relations Manager, or Quality Assurance Head, driving strategy and innovation within the organization.


Professional Development Strategies

Long-term career growth in the international voice process domain requires a proactive approach to professional development. Here are some effective strategies:

Continuous Skill Improvement

Invest time in developing interpersonal skills, customer engagement techniques, and mastering new CRM technologies to stay relevant in the field.

Networking and Mentorship

Building a robust professional network enables knowledge sharing and new opportunities. Seeking mentorship from seasoned professionals can provide invaluable guidance and direction.

Performance Evaluation

Regularly evaluate your performance and seek feedback for improvement. Self-assessment and constructive criticism are vital for personal and professional growth.


Challenges and How to Overcome Them

While the job is rewarding, it comes with its set of challenges such as high stress, burnout, and maintaining effective communication over different time zones. Here are some tips to navigate these obstacles:

Stress Management

Adopting mindfulness, regular exercise, and a balanced work-life regimen are crucial in managing stress and maintaining mental well-being.

Adaptability

Staying adaptable and flexible in learning and implementing new procedures ensures you remain capable of handling technological advancements and shifts in market demands.
